How to use oxygen cylinders
1 Be sure the flow regulator knob is set at zero
2 Make sure the T-handle is tight.
3 Place the cylinder wrench on the cylinder’s
on/off valve, located at the top of the cylinder.
4 Open the valve by turning it counterclockwise one full turn. As the valve opens,
the gauge on the regulator will show the
amount of pressure in the cylinder. A full
cylinder will read about 2000 psi (pounds per
square inch).
5 Adjust the flow regulator knob to the flow
rate your doctor prescribed.
6 Attach tubing to the nipple adaptor on the
regulator.

How long does a tank that size last?
4-6 hours if set on 2 liters. If set higher then won’t last as long
